Custom gunite is the right method for Thomaston pool construction. Gunite construction allows complete design flexibility — any shape, any depth, any feature — and delivers structural performance measured in decades. Combined with premium finishes (glass tile, natural stone coping, Pebble Technology surfaces), a gunite pool becomes a permanent architectural feature that enhances both the livability and the resale value of the property.

Permitting and Regulatory Landscape
Pool construction in Thomaston requires navigating Thomaston's R-1 (one-acre) and R-2 (two-acre) residential zones. Properties near regulated wetlands or watercourses require additional review — in Thomaston's case primarily addressing the Naugatuck River corridor, the Branch Brook, and the Northfield Brook Lake margin. Investment and Timeline
Custom pool construction in Thomaston typically ranges from $165,000 to $275,000 depending on site complexity, finish selections, and integrated features. Construction timelines run 12 to 20 weeks from groundbreaking, with permitting adding 4 to 8 weeks before construction begins.
